Factors That Affect Mental Health Negatively
There are many factors that can negatively affect a person’s mental health. Some of these include:
Stress
Stress is a normal reaction to difficult situations, but long-term stress can have negative impacts on mental health. When people are under stress, their bodies release cortisol, a hormone that helps the body prepare for danger. Cortisol can increase the risk of mental health problems, including anxiety, depression, and addiction. Too much cortisol can also lead to weight gain, muscle loss, and memory problems.
There are ways to reduce stress and improve mental health. One way is to develop a stress management plan. This plan should include specific strategies for reducing stress, such as exercise, meditation, and other stress relieving activities.
Depression
Depression affects mental health in a number of ways. Depression can cause a decrease in energy and an inability to concentrate, which can lead to problems at school or work.
Depression can also lead to problems with sleeping and eating, as well as anxiety and stress. In addition, depression can lead to a decrease in self-esteem and social interactions. Finally, depression can have a negative impact on physical health, including an increased risk of developing heart disease, stroke, and diabetes.

-Substance abuse
Substance abuse can have a negative effect on mental health. Substance abuse can lead to an increased risk for developing mental health conditions such as depression, anxiety, and bipolar disorder. It can also lead to a decrease in physical health, including obesity and heart disease.

How To Maintain Good Mental Health
There are a few things you can do to maintain a good mental health. First, make sure to have regular checkups with your doctor.
This can help identify any problems early and allow you to take steps to address them.
Second, make sure to get enough exercise.This can help to improve your mood and decrease your stress. Finally, make sure to have a support system. This can be friends, family, or a mental health professional.
